public void GetOneMessage() { Fannie.Message mess = new Fannie.Message(); DataSet ds = mess.GetOneNotice(id); tbTitle.Text = ds.Tables[0].Rows[0]["Title"].ToString(); tbContent.Text = ds.Tables[0].Rows[0]["Contents"].ToString(); lbTime.Text = ds.Tables[0].Rows[0]["SenderTime"].ToString(); }
protected void gvNotice_RowDeleting(object sender, GridViewDeleteEventArgs e) { Fannie.Message mes = new Fannie.Message(); int id = Convert.ToInt32(gvNotice.DataKeys[e.RowIndex].Value); if (mes.DeleteNotice(id) > 0) { Response.Write("<script>alert('删除成功')</script>"); GetAllNotice(); } }
protected void btnSend_Click(object sender, EventArgs e) { string title = tbTitle.Text; string manager = Request.Cookies["user"].Value.ToString(); string content = tbContent.Text; string year = tYeat.Value; string[] str = new string[4] { title, manager, content, year }; Fannie.Message mes = new Fannie.Message(); if (mes.InsertNotice(str) > 0) { Response.Write("<script>alert('成功发布公告');location.href='../Public/Message.aspx'</script>"); } }
private void GetAllNotice() { Fannie.Message mes = new Fannie.Message(); DataSet ds = mes.GetAllNotice(); DataColumn dc = new DataColumn(); dc.ColumnName = "PId"; ds.Tables[0].Columns.Add(dc); for (int i = 0; i < ds.Tables[0].Rows.Count; i++) { ds.Tables[0].Rows[i]["Pid"] = (i + 1).ToString(); } for (int i = 0; i < ds.Tables[0].Rows.Count; i++) { ds.Tables[0].Rows[i]["Title"] = SubStr(Convert.ToString(ds.Tables[0].Rows[i]["Title"]), 40); ds.Tables[0].Rows[i]["Contents"] = SubStr(Convert.ToString(ds.Tables[0].Rows[i]["Contents"]), 50); } gvNotice.DataKeyNames = new string[] { "NoticeNo" }; gvNotice.DataSource = ds; gvNotice.DataBind(); }